Going North
We departed from Scarborough Yacht Club for Moololaba on 17 June and arrived at 15.40 hrs and enjoyed the YC and did some minor maintenance lots of walking and set sail on 22 June for the Wide Bay bar, a treacherous piece of water, we were accompanied by Follow the Sun, Nankeen and Supa Nova 2 after departing at 0345 hrs to get the tide right at the Bar, we stayed overnight at Pelican Bay

Off to Garry's Anchorage in the Strait and the next day onto King Fisher Resort a great place for Yachties to relax, then onto to Urangan a really bustling NEW resort., then onto Bundaberg, where we once lived for 5 years arriving there on 27 June.

We caught with our old friend Rod who manufactures the famous Jabiru light aircraft in Bundaberg and we flew up to Pancake to check out our next port of call.

We departed for Pancake on 2 July and overnighted in comfort with the yacht Follow the Sun and off in the morning to Gladstone and caught up with John on Conda's Mate and tried to go up the passage but tides were not suitable, by the way from Brisbane Julie and myself did all the sailing. we departed for the Keppels on 5 July and the following morning on to Island Head where we stayed for 2 nights.
